What is Content Writing?

Content writing is the process of creating written material for online and offline platforms, designed to engage, inform, and persuade a target audience. It encompasses a variety of forms, from short social media posts to in-depth research articles and blogs. The goal of content writing is to provide value to the reader while aligning with the goals of the organization, business, or individual publishing the content.

In today’s digital landscape, content writing plays a crucial role in building brand awareness, increasing website traffic, and establishing authority in a particular field. Whether you’re writing for a website, a company blog, or a marketing campaign, the quality and relevance of your content are vital to achieving success.

Content writing is not just about putting words on paper; it involves research, creativity, strategy, and the ability to adapt the writing style to various platforms and audiences. As the internet continues to evolve, the demand for skilled content writers who can produce clear, effective, and engaging content is only growing.

Types of Content Writing

Content writing is a broad field with multiple specializations. Writers often focus on a particular niche or style of writing, depending on their expertise and the needs of the market. Here are some common types of content writing:

1. SEO Writing

SEO (Search Engine Optimization) writing focuses on creating content that ranks high in search engine results. This involves using keywords, optimizing metadata, and crafting content that aligns with search engine algorithms. SEO writing is crucial for driving organic traffic to websites.

2. Blog Writing

Blog writing is one of the most popular forms of content writing. Blogs are typically informal, informative, and engaging. They cover a wide range of topics and serve to educate or entertain an audience while promoting a brand or business subtly.

3. Copywriting

Copywriting is focused on persuasive writing. It involves creating compelling headlines, advertisements, and promotional materials that encourage readers to take a specific action, such as making a purchase or signing up for a newsletter.

4. Technical Writing

Technical writing involves creating instructional or explanatory documents that help readers understand complex topics. Examples include user manuals, how-to guides, and white papers. This type of writing requires a strong understanding of the subject matter.

5. Social Media Content

Writing for social media platforms involves crafting concise, engaging posts that attract attention and encourage interaction. Social media content is usually short, punchy, and designed to grab attention quickly in a fast-paced environment.

6. Email Marketing

Email marketing content aims to nurture relationships with potential and existing customers. It includes newsletters, promotional offers, and automated emails. Writing effective email content requires an understanding of audience segmentation and tailored messaging.

7. Script Writing

Script writing is used for creating content for video, podcasts, or audio platforms. Whether it’s a YouTube video, podcast episode, or ad script, this form of writing must be engaging, clear, and suited to verbal presentation.

Basic Writing Styles in Content Writing

Every type of content requires a unique writing style to effectively convey its message. Below are some of the most common writing styles used in content writing:

1. Narrative Style

A narrative style tells a story, whether real or fictional. It is often used in blog posts, articles, or brand storytelling to engage the audience emotionally. This style works best when aiming to build a connection with readers by taking them on a journey through a relatable story.

2. Descriptive Style

Descriptive writing uses vivid language to create an image in the reader’s mind. This style is ideal for product descriptions, travel blogs, and any content where painting a clear, visual picture is essential to capturing attention.

3. Expository Style

Expository writing explains or informs. It is straightforward, objective, and factual, making it suitable for educational articles, how-to guides, and technical writing. The goal is to provide clear, concise information without personal opinions or emotions.

4. Persuasive Style

Persuasive writing aims to convince the reader to take a specific action or adopt a particular viewpoint. It is often used in marketing materials, advertisements, and sales copy, where the writer’s goal is to drive conversions or influence decisions.

What is a Content Style of Writing?

Content style refers to the tone and voice used in writing, which aligns with the brand or platform’s objectives. A content style shapes how the information is presented to the audience, influencing their perception of the brand or message. It can vary depending on the audience, the platform, and the purpose of the content.

For example, a fashion blog may adopt a casual, conversational style, while a financial report will use a formal, professional tone. A strong content style ensures consistency across all forms of communication, making it easier for readers to connect with the message.

Key Elements of Content Style:

  • Tone: The attitude conveyed in the writing (e.g., friendly, serious, humorous).
  • Voice: The unique personality or style of the writer or brand.
  • Purpose: The overall goal of the content, whether to inform, entertain, persuade, or sell.

Understanding how to adapt your content style to fit different platforms and audiences is a crucial skill for any content writer.
